High CO <sub>2</sub> Exposure Due to Facemask Wear Does Not Impair Students’ Cognition

2023-02-23

Abstract excerpt

COVID-19 provided the opportunity to study responses to long-term exposure of significantly elevated CO<sub>2</sub> concentrations from facemask wear. Our study examines how high CO<sub>2</sub> exposure impacts cognition. We hypothesize despite a sharp increase of local CO<sub>2</sub>, facemask wear will not impact cognition due to long-term adaptation from mandated wear.  This randomized control trial involved 60...
